started mystery shopping as soon as possible. The regulations for Mystery
Shopping in Nevada are different than anywhere else in the country.

As you may be aware, the State of Nevada requires that all mystery shoppers
hold a valid work card for mystery shopping and all mystery shopping
companies must hold a valid Private Investigator's license in order to hire
mystery shoppers. BestMark is one of the few companies who are legally able
to work in Nevada and we are currently adding new shoppers in Nevada.

Please indicate to me if you already have a Work Card and are conducting
assignments for another mystery shopping company. You will not have to
reapply for a work card. I will send you over the required paperwork and you
can have it processed and send me a copy of your current work card as well.
As soon as that is complete, you can begin taking assignments immediately!
If you do not currently have a work card from another mystery shopping
company, I can send you the necessary paperwork and instructions for online
registration with the Nevada Private Investigator's Licensing Board. The
work card currently costs $90.00, all of which will be reimbursed to you
once you have successfully completed 8 shops for us in Nevada!

Yes, Nevada requires a special work card that allows you to work under the supervision of a licensed PI agency. The penalties for doing shops in NV without such authorization are quite stiff. Do a search here, using all dates, for "Nevada" and you will find lots of info.

Gina, you have found a forum of mystery shoppers, not a mystery shopping business. It sounds like you have never registered with any mystery shopping company and received an unsolicited e-mail. If that is the case the e-mail you have is spam and you should not have any more contact with them. Most of the scams will include links (don't click on them) and offers of incredibly high pay ($200 or more per assignment) which is paid in advance. The average mystery shop actually pays anywhere from $5 to $15 and we are never, ever, ever, paid in advance for our work. We perform assignments, make any necessary purchases and we are then paid anywhere from 2 weeks to 3 months later.
